Also called Z-52, this grass variety is an improved cultivar of Zoysia japonica. It has a medium, dark-green color with intermediate leaf texture and shoot density. Meyer Zoysia is slightly less shade tolerant than Emerald Zoysia. It also has the fastest spring green-up. The most cold tolerant zoysia grass, it is grown as far north as Pennsylvania and Missouri. This is the zoysia grass often advertised as the “super” grass in newspapers and magazines.

Emerald Zoysia is a hybrid Zoysia and was developed in the 1960’s. It has a very slow growth habit and requires the most care of any other Zoysia grass. Emerald Zoysia requires a reel mower to be maintained correctly.

Fescue Blend is a turf-type tall, fine fescue grass grown from seed. This is quality fescue that grows well in all areas of fescue adaptation. Palmer’s Turf Nursery hand-picks fescue varieties each year to provide you with sod that has the best heat, drought, and disease resistances available. In addition to the benefits all tall, fine fescue grass varieties have, Fescue Blend Fescue has superior Rhizoctonia brown patch resistance, exceptional salt tolerance, and a much stronger shade tolerance. Fescue Blend Fescue is by far the most popular turf grass choice in the Tennessee Valley.
